QuickStart

A place to get you started on how to use this module and set up your work station.

Install from PyPi

$ pip install geocoder

Using iPython with Geocoder

$ pip install ipython
$ ipython

Using the TAB key after entering '.' you will see all the available providers.

>>> import geocoder
>>> g = geocoder.

Command Line Interface

The command line tool allows you to geocode one or many strings, either passed as an argument, passed via STDIN, or contained in a referenced file.

$ geocode "Ottawa"
{
  "accuracy": "Rooftop",
  "quality": "PopulatedPlace",
  "lng": -75.68800354003906,
  "status": "OK",
  "locality": "Ottawa",
  "country": "Canada",
  "provider": "bing",
  "state": "ON",
  "location": "Ottawa",
  "address": "Ottawa, ON",
  "lat": 45.389198303222656
}

Now, suppose you have a file with two lines, which you want to geocode.

$ geocode `textfile.txt`
{"status": "OK", "locality": "Ottawa", ...}
{"status": "OK", "locality": "Boston", ...}

The output is, by default, sent to stdout, so it can be conveniently parsed by json parsing tools like jq.

$ geocode `textfile.txt` | jq [.lat,.lng,.country] -c
[45.389198303222656,-75.68800354003906,"Canada"]
[42.35866165161133,-71.0567398071289,"United States"]

Parsing a batch geocode to CSV can also be done with jq. Build your headers first then run the geocode application.

$ echo 'lat,lng,locality' > test.csv
$ geocode cities.txt | jq [.lat,.lng,.locality] -c | jq -r '@csv' >> test.csv

Reverse Geocoding

The term geocoding generally refers to translating a human-readable address into a location on a map. The process of doing the opposite, translating a location on the map into a human-readable address, is known as reverse geocoding. Using Geocoder you can retrieve Reverse's geocoded data from Google Geocoding API.

Python Example

At the moment the two providers that have the functionality of Reverse geocoding are Google & Bing. Simply include the reverse=True parameter.

>>> import geocoder
>>> g = geocoder.bing(['lat','lng'], reverse=True)
>>> g.address
'453 Booth Street, Ottawa'
